Raw pepper is sourced directly from Cambodia's Kampot Province, which is said to be the world's highest pepper region.

Raw pepper is made by picking and drying peppercorns and salting them instead of drying them. The method of use is different from the usual dry pepper, and the fruit is sprinkled as it is in cooking without milling. If you sprinkle sashimi with olive oil, you can put it on simply grilled meat such as carpaccio-style, yakiniku, and steak It is also recommended to eat it. One of the recommended ways to use it is to add a few grains to ramen noodles as an accent. By using this product, you can make the taste more impactful.
